Ingredient Notes:

For the Chicken:

  • Chicken thighs or chicken breasts provide a juicy and flavorful protein base.
  • A blend of seasonings like sal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, and paprika enhances the chicken’s taste.
  • Olive oil is used for cooking the chicken to perfection.

For the Sauce:

  • Butter adds richness and flavor to the sauce.
  • Onions and garlic provide a savory depth of flavor.
  • Chicken broth and heavy cream create a luscious and creamy sauce.
  • Dried thyme, parsley, salt, and pepper add a herbaceous and well-balanced taste.
  • Cornstarch can be mixed with water to thicken the sauce if needed.

For the Rice:

  • Long-grain white rice serves as a fluffy and versatile side dish.
  • Water or chicken broth can be used to cook the rice, adding extra flavor.

Step-by-Step Instructions:

  1. Season the chicken with sal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, and paprika.
  2. Cook the chicken in olive oil until browned and cooked through.
  3. In the same pan, melt butter and sauté onions and garlic.
  4. Add chicken broth, heavy cream, thyme, parsley, salt, and pepper to the pan.
  5. Simmer the sauce until thickened, then add the cooked chicken back in.
  6. Cook the rice according to package instructions.
  7. Serve the creamy smothered chicken over the rice and enjoy!

Storage and Reheating Tips:

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at in the microwave or on the stovetop, adding a splash of broth or cream to revive the sauce.

Description

This Creamy Smothered Chicken and Rice recipe combines tender chicken with a rich and flavorful cream sauce served over fluffy white rice for a comforting and satisfying meal.


Ingredients

Scale

For the Chicken:

  • 2 lbs chicken thighs or chicken breasts
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il

For the Sauce:

  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1 small onion, diced
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 cups chicken broth
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1 teaspoon dried parsley
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t (adjust to taste)
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on cornstarch (mixed with 1 tablespoon water to thicken, if needed)

For the Rice:

  • 1 1/2 cups long-grain white rice
  • 3 cups water or chicken broth

Instructions

  1. Season the chicken: In a bowl, mix salt, black p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, and paprika. Rub the mixture over the chicken.
  2. Cook the chicken: Heat olive oil in a skillet and cook the chicken until browned and cooked through.
  3. Make the sauce: In the same skillet, sauté onion and garlic. Add chicken broth, cream, thyme, parsley, salt, and pepper. Simmer until thickened.
  4. Prepare the rice: In a separate pot, cook rice according to package instructions.
  5. Serve: Serve the creamy chicken over the rice and enjoy!

Notes

  • You can add vegetables like peas or carrots to the dish for added flavor and nutrition.
  • Feel free to adjust the seasoning in the sauce to suit your taste preferences.
